newborough beach

navigate by keyword : anglesey beach blue coast coastal hills horizontal island landscape llanddwyn llyn mountains nature newborough peninsula reserve ribs sand sky summer sunny wales welsh

View of Welsh mountains from Newborough beach Royalty Free Stock Photo
Newborough Beach Royalty Free Stock Photo
Newborough Beach Royalty Free Stock Photo
Newborough Beach Royalty Free Stock Photo
Newborough Beach, Anglesey, Wales Royalty Free Stock Photo
Newborough Beach Royalty Free Stock Photo
Newborough beach Royalty Free Stock Photo
Newborough beach
Low tide on a deserted Newborough beach, Anglesey Royalty Free Stock Photo
Through a gap in the sand dunes to Newborough Beach Royalty Free Stock Photo
Newborough Beach and a dog Royalty Free Stock Photo
Newborough Beach Royalty Free Stock Photo
Newborough beach Royalty Free Stock Photo
An almost deserted Newborough Beach at low tide on Anglesey, Wales. Royalty Free Stock Photo
Newborough Beach, Anglesey, Wales, on an overcast autumn morning Royalty Free Stock Photo
Newborough beach, Anglesy Wales overlooking Llanddwyn island and the Lyn peninsula


Stockphotos.ro (c) 2025. All stock photos are provided by Dreamstime and are copyrighted by their respective owners.